英文摘要
The aim of this study is the building of technical bases for appropriate methods of evaluation for orthodontic treatments by means of the study of the relationships among orthodontic force, bone density, bone remodeling and angiogenesis. We established in vivo imaging technique for monitoring of angiogenesis in mouse subcutaneous tumor by using fluorescent probes. We developed experimental technique to monitor the change of periodontium when the orthodontic force was applied. The experiments using mouse model of osteoporosis suggested the implication of bone density and orthodontic force to bone remodeling and angiogenesis in periodontium.
